Understanding California’s Daylight Saving Time Dilemma

California still observes daylight saving time because federal law prevents states from switching to standard time year-round without amending the Uniform Time Act.  Explanation In 2018, California voters passed Proposition 7, which gave the state legislature the power to change daylight saving time.  To change daylight...
